Ice Cream, I Scream is a quirky comedy that takes you to Mugla, where the warmth of the sun matches the chilly rivalry between Ali, an ice cream salesman, and the corporate giants. The film has this charmingly chaotic atmosphere, especially when Ali rides around on his bright yellow ice cream motorbike, trying to drum up business and fend off the village's mischievous kids. There's a real sense of community here, and you can almost taste the ice cream as the narrative unfolds. The pacing feels a bit uneven at times, but it adds to the charm, letting moments breathe. The performances are endearing, if not perfectly polished, capturing the essence of small-town life and the struggle against a corporate tide.
